是否可以安装特定的吊舱?
我希望我可以运行$pod install <podName>
并且只能安装该pod,但是这似乎不起作用。 有没有办法做到这一点?
install
命令有一些工作在这种方式(例如$pod update <podName>
。是否有install
等效?
是的你可以!
首先使用pod outdated
了解哪个荚是过时的,那么你知道哪个荚不是 ,例如,说你的AFNetworking是最新的。
然后使用pod update AFNetworking
和cocoapod将安装您新添加的pod而不触及其他pod(s)。
顺便说一下,我正在使用最新的cocoapod 0.39,但我认为这个技巧适用于以前的cocoapod版本。
我也使用这个技巧来删除没有碰到其他豆荚的豆荚
不,不可能安装特定的吊舱。
如果您执行pod install
命令,则由于存在Podfile.lock
,因此没有任何一个已安装的pod将被下载并重新安装。 那么,你为什么这样问呢? 如果您尝试运行pod install
,则会看到已下载的pod将显示“ Using pod
而非“ Installing pod